EuroMed Human Rights MonitorGaza: Israel commits another massacre against civilians trying to access communications and Internet services

Palestinian Territory – The Israeli army has committed another horrific massacre against Palestinian civilians in Gaza City who were trying to access communications and Internet services.

This adds another crime to the long list of atrocities that Israel’s army has committed against the civilian population in the Gaza Strip since its genocidal war began last October.

Israel has committed full-fledged war crimes and crimes against humanity as part of its genocide in the Strip, ongoing for nearly eight consecutive months now.

Notably, the Israeli army continues to repeatedly target and kill Palestinian civilians, including journalists, as they attempt to access communications and Internet services to reach their families or employers.

Using aerial bombardment, snipers, or drones, Israel directly targets these individuals—who pose no threat or danger to its army—in various areas of the Gaza Strip.

An Israeli drone fired a missile at a group of Palestinian civilians in the heart of Gaza City on Wednesday afternoon.

The civilians had gathered at an “Internet distribution point” on Al-Jalaa Street at the Ayoun Hospital intersection. The missile killed at least four people, including a child, whose body parts were recovered. Fifteen others were injured, some with moderate to severe wounds.

Hassan Saeed Barakat, the father of one victim of the Israeli bombing, told the Euro-Med Monitor team that dozens of people had gathered to attempt to contact their family members when an Israeli drone launched a surprise missile attack. The attack directly targeted the tent being used as an Internet distribution point, causing the massive and deadly explosion.

Instead of accessing the Internet via electronic SIM cards, Palestinian civilians have recently been turning to these random distribution points and physically high places to try to access communication networks due to the systematic and widespread destruction of civilian objects by Israeli forces in the Strip. With the destruction of mobile phone network transmission stations, Palestinians are struggling to communicate.

Israel has deliberately destroyed the Gaza Strip’s only terrestrial network and the aerial transmission stations of mobile phone networks located on building roofs. This has resulted in the majority of the Strip’s residents being forced to search for other ways to connect with people both in and outside of the enclave, which is not an easy technical feat, especially given the extreme degree of violence that civilians are frequently subjected to.

Since the Israeli military invasion began on 7 October 2023, Israel has shut off communications and the Internet in the Gaza Strip no fewer than 13 times with its direct targeting of civilian telecommunications infrastructure and electrical generators. Israel has also prevented the necessary fuel supply from reaching these generators.

The Palestinian Telecommunications Company reported on Sunday 13 May that “air and artillery bombardments carried out by the Israeli occupation” caused the suspension of Internet services that had just recently been restored to a significant portion of the Strip’s population.

The Israeli army has damaged and destroyed a great deal of communications towers as well as high-rise buildings that housed transmission booster stations, particularly in the Gaza City and North Gaza governorates. This has resulted in heavily weakened services that are interrupted for long periods of time.

Despite prior coordination efforts carried out by the United Nations, the Israeli army has also repeatedly targeted technical crews from telecommunications and Internet companies working to repair lines, killing several of them and injuring others to varying degrees.
